A convenient and simple three-component synthesis of substituted pyridylacetic acid derivatives is reported. The approach centers on the dual reactivity of Meldrum's acid derivatives, initially as nucleophiles to perform substitution on activated pyridine-<i>N</i>-oxides, then as electrophiles with a range of nucleophiles to trigger ring-opening and decarboxylation. ...[more]
